Description
Technical Field
The utility model relates to the technical field of steel plate degreasing and soaking cleaning machines, in particular to a steel plate degreasing and soaking cleaning machine.
Background
At present, the steel plate is in the degreasing and soaking process, the automation degree is low, and degreasing fluid generated in the soaking process is accumulated in a soaking box, so that the degreasing and soaking process is not beneficial to recycling, the degreasing effect of the steel plate is poor, and the use cost of the degreasing fluid is increased.
SUMMERY OF THE UTILITY MODEL
Technical problem to be solved
Aiming at the defects of the prior art, the utility model provides a steel plate degreasing, soaking and cleaning machine which has the advantages that the fluidity of degreasing liquid is improved by adopting a degreasing liquid circulation mode, filtered degreasing liquid is stored separately, and the use cost of the degreasing liquid is improved.
(II) technical scheme
In order to achieve the purpose of improving the working efficiency of the steel plate degreasing and soaking cleaning machine, the utility model provides the following technical scheme: a steel plate degreasing, soaking and cleaning machine comprises a plurality of soaking boxes, wherein a feeding device is arranged on one side of each soaking box, a brushing box is arranged on the other side of each soaking box, a circulating cleaning box is arranged on one side of each brushing box, a discharging device is arranged on one side of each circulating cleaning box, a plurality of soaking boxes are provided with corresponding liquid storage boxes, liquid inlet regions, filtering regions and liquid storage regions are respectively arranged on the liquid storage boxes, the liquid inlet regions, the filtering regions and the liquid storage regions are communicated with one another, the liquid inlet regions and the soaking boxes are communicated through liquid outlet pipes, liquid inlet pipes communicated with the soaking boxes are arranged on the liquid storage regions, cover plates are arranged on the upper portions of the liquid storage regions, the brushing boxes and the soaking boxes, a plurality of conveying rollers are arranged on the feeding devices, the brushing boxes, the circulating cleaning boxes and the discharging devices, collars are sleeved on the outer walls of the conveying rollers, and are connected with a transmission device, the upper part of the circulating cleaning box is provided with a control box, and exhaust pipes are arranged on the soaking box and the brushing box.
Preferably, the soaking box, the brushing box, the circulating cleaning box and the conveying rollers in the discharging device are distributed in an upper-lower double-layer mode.
Preferably, a plurality of brushing rollers are arranged in the brushing box, the brushing rollers are distributed among the conveying rollers at intervals, and the outer diameter of each brushing roller is larger than that of each conveying roller.
Preferably, the circulating cleaning box and the brushing box are internally provided with spray heads, the circulating cleaning box is internally distributed in a double-layer mode, and the spray heads are symmetrically distributed on two sides of the conveying roller.
Preferably, the ferrules are uniformly distributed on the outer wall of the conveying roller at equal intervals, and the ferrules are made of plastic or rubber materials.

Drawings
FIG. 1 is a schematic structural view of the present invention;
FIG. 2 is a schematic view of a reservoir connection according to the present invention;
fig. 3 is a schematic view of a ferrule connection of the present invention.
In the figure: 1. a soaking box; 2. a feeding device; 3. a brushing box; 4. a circulating cleaning tank; 5. a liquid storage tank; 6. a liquid inlet zone; 7. a filtration zone; 8. a liquid storage area; 9. a liquid outlet pipe; 10. a liquid inlet pipe; 11. a cover plate; 12. a conveying roller; 13. a discharging device; 14. a transmission device; 15. a ferrule; 16. a control box; 17. brushing the roller; 18. a spray head; 19. and (4) exhausting the gas.
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ments. All other embodiments, which can be derived by a person skilled in the art from the embodiments given herein without making any creative effort, shall fall within the protection scope of the present invention.
Referring to fig. 1-3, the steel plate soaking device comprises a plurality of soaking tanks 1, a feeding device 2 is arranged on one side of each soaking tank 1, a brushing tank 3 is arranged on the other side of each soaking tank 1, conveying rollers 12 in each soaking tank 1, each brushing tank 3, a circulating cleaning tank 4 and a discharging device 13 are distributed in an up-down double-layer manner to improve the degreasing cleaning effect, a plurality of brushing rollers 17 are arranged in each brushing tank 3, the brushing rollers 17 are distributed at intervals among the conveying rollers 12, the outer diameter of each brushing roller 17 is larger than that of each conveying roller 12 to improve the cleaning effect, the circulating cleaning tank 4 is arranged on one side of each brushing tank 3, nozzles 18 are arranged in each circulating cleaning tank 4 and each brushing tank 3, the circulating cleaning tank 4 is distributed in a double-layer manner, the nozzles 18 are symmetrically distributed on two sides of the conveying rollers 12 to facilitate up-down spraying, the spraying effect is guaranteed, and the feeding device 2 conveys a steel plate into the soaking tanks 1, the steel plate is limited by the conveying rollers 12, the soaking effect is improved, the steel plate soaked by the conveying rollers 12 is conveyed to the next operation area, the cleaning box 3 is internally provided with a spray head 18 and a cleaning roller 17, the steel plate is sprayed and brushed at the same time, the circulating cleaning box 4 is used for spraying and cleaning the steel plate up and down again, and finally the discharging device 13 is used for discharging, so that the automation degree is high, the labor consumption is reduced, degreasing fluid can circulate in the soaking boxes 1 and the liquid storage boxes 5, the environment-friendly use is facilitated, one side of the circulating cleaning box 4 is provided with the discharging device 13, a plurality of soaking boxes 1 are provided with the corresponding liquid storage boxes 5, the liquid storage boxes 5 are respectively provided with a liquid inlet area 6, a filtering area 7 and a liquid storage area 8, the liquid inlet area 6 is communicated with the filtering area 7 and the liquid storage area 8, the liquid inlet area 6 is communicated with the soaking boxes 1 through the liquid outlet pipe 9, the liquid inlet pipe 10 communicated with the soaking boxes 1 is arranged on the liquid storage area 8, liquid storage area 8, scrubbing box 3 and 1 upper portion of soaking box all are provided with apron 11, soaking box 1, feed arrangement 2, scrubbing box 3, be provided with a plurality of conveying rollers 12 on circulation washing case 4 and the discharging device 13, the cover is provided with lasso 15 on the conveying roller 12 outer wall, and conveying roller 12 is connected with transmission 14, lasso 15 is equidistance evenly distributed on conveying roller 12 outer wall, and lasso 15 is plastics or rubber materials, be favorable to playing the cushioning effect, prevent that too big steel sheet from causing the damage of pressure, circulation washing case 4 upper portion is provided with control box 16, soaking box 1 and scrubbing box 3 are last to be provided with blast pipe 19.
